Use A Magic Eraser For Tomato Sauce Stains On Shoes

Clothes arent the only victims of tomato sauce. When spaghetti or tomato juice falls on the floor, it leaves your shoes splattered. While most footwear is washable, your sneakers rubber accents and soles are tougher to clean.

A Magic Eraser is a foam block containing hundreds of air bubbles. Magic Erasers are mildly abrasive and best used on the rubber accents and soles of your shoes or other hard surfaces. Purchase a Magic Eraser and rub the foam over the stained area on the rubber parts of your shoes to destroy the red coloring.

Removing Tomato Sauce Stains From Clothing

A baking soda paste is effortless to make and apply. The deep cleaning and deodorizing properties of baking soda make short work of wet and dried tomato sauce stains.

  • 6 heaped tbsp baking soda powder
  • 4 tbsp warm water

Stir the powder and water into a thick paste, smear over the red mark, and leave for five minutes. Scrub the baking soda paste into the sauce stain with a brush, rinse out well, and let it dry.

You can also try this simple remedy as the way to get oil stains out of clothes. Let some baking soda sit on the stain to absorb as much of it as possible, dust off and apply the paste and scrub. Rinse and allow to dry. The oil stain should disappear.

    Is Bleach Useful Can It Remove Tomato Sauce Stains

    Bleach has been popularly used in washing clothes as it has strong components that help in breaking down stains. However, bleach should only be used in white clothes and garments. Another thing to note is fabric sensitivity. Make sure to look at your clothes wash instructions and see if bleach is okay.

    When you are removing tomato stains from colored clothes, make sure to use detergents without bleach in them. Bleach can cause white stains and other forms of discoloration on your colored clothes.

    Does Hot Water Set A Stain

    Hot water will set some stains, particularly protein based stains. Use cold or warm water on these before washing in hot water. When removing a stain, treat the stain from the back of the fabric unless otherwise noted. This will force the stain off the surface instead of driving it through the fabric.

    Homemade Versatile Stain Remover For Tomato Sauce

    Dont let a sauce splatter keep you from wearing your clothes. Craft a batch of this DIY tomato sauce cleaning fluid to benefit from the stain removal properties of hydrogen peroxide and laundry detergent and the pleasant fragrance of essential oils.

    • 2 cups pure hydrogen peroxide
    • 1 cup liquid laundry detergent
    • 10 drops of any essential oil

    Combine in a spray canister and apply to the discolored area. Apply the cleaning solution to the sauce stain with a cloth or a toothbrush and let it soak for one minute. Rinse your clothing with cold water and repeat as needed to leave it clean and smelling lovely.

    Rinse The Soap Thoroughly

    After the stain sits covered in the laundry detergent for at least 10 minutes, you need to rinse the soap before it dries. Run cold water over the area until you get clear water.

    After rinsing, observe the stained area to see if the tomato sauce stain is completely gone. If gone, you can machine wash the cloth normally before running it in the dryer.

    However, if the stain is not removed, you will need to proceed to the following steps as running a stained fabric in the dryer will permanently feed the color into the cloth fibers.

    Removing Tomato Stains From Unwashable Fabrics

    How to remove a spaghetti stain from clothes
    • Scrape off as much the tomato as possible, without spreading it further.
    • Using a damp sponge, gently blot at the stain to remove any liquid.
    • Use a dry, clean cloth to blot dry.
    • Move the item into the sunshine to allow the UV rays to break down any remaining stain.
    • If the stain is oily, use a little liquid dish detergent on the oily parts of the stain before following the steps above.

    How Do You Remove Tomato Sauce Stains From Clothes With Alternative Products

    Love the Red Stuff? Remove Tomato Stains From Clothes and Carpet ...

    It is easy to remove even dried-in tomato stains with HG stain away no. 4. There are alternatives. They are often aggressive products. Whether you should use them depends on the fabric and the colour. You can use the following tips at your own risk:

    1. Remove tomato stains from cotton clothes with baking soda and hydrogen peroxide

    Hydrogen peroxide is suitable for removing dried-in tomato stains from cotton. Be careful! This is an aggressive product. Make a paste of baking soda and hydrogen peroxide and apply it to the tomato sauce stain. Leave it for approximately 10 minutes. Rinse the garment and then wash it in accordance with the care label.

    2. Remove tomato stains from woollen clothing with lemon juice

    You can remove dried-in tomato stains from wool with lemon juice. Sprinkle a little salt on the stain first and rub it in carefully. Then use cotton wool to apply lemon juice to the stain. Then rinse it thoroughly with cold water.

    3. Remove tomato stains from synthetic clothes with white vinegar

    White vinegar can be used to remove dried-in tomato stains from synthetic clothes. First dilute a few drops of vinegar in a glass of water. Apply this to the tomato stain and rub it in carefully. Then rinse with cold water and wash the garment normally.

    Cleaning Acrylic Fabric Nylon Polyester Spandexxresearch Source

  • 1Scrape the sauce off of the fabric. As quickly as possible, remove the sauce from the surface of the fabric without pushing it further in. You can use a paper towel or a rag to quickly wipe the tomato sauce off the fabric. XResearch source
  • 2Sponge the stain with cool water.XResearch source Work outwards with your sponge from the center of your stain.Advertisement
  • 3Apply lemon or lime juice to the stain. Either sponge the stain with lemon juice or use a slice of lemon, and rub the stain with it.
  • If the fabric is white, you can use white vinegar or hydrogen peroxide directly on the stain instead of lemon juice.XResearch source
  • 4Use a stain remover on the stain. Find a stain removing stick, spray or gel, and apply it to the stain. Let the stain remover sit for 15 minutes.
  • 5Flush the stain, and then check to see if the stain is still there. On the back of the stain, run cool water through the fabric. Hold the fabric up to light to see if the stain remains.
  • 6Soak the stain if it is still there. Soak the fabric for 30 minutes in a solution of:
  • 1 quart warm water
  • 1 tablespoon white vinegar
  • 7Rinse the fabric with water and dry it in the sun. Put the stain in direct sunlight with the stain side facing out. The sunlight should break down any of the remaining stain.
  • 8Wash the fabric. Follow the care instructions for the fabric, and wash your fabric normally.
